SHELL Modem Menu v1.0 Ryan Snodgrass REGISTRATION $5.00
COMM MAY90 COMMUNICATIONS MENU SHELL PROCOMM SNODGRASS
FILES: smmenu10.sdn
New Release
SHELL Modem Menu was developed mainly for Procomm Plus
communication program, but was also designed so you could
also use it straight for the DOS prompt. It was also
designed so that you could edit the menu from within the
program so as you would not have to exit the program and have
a text editor to redesign the program.
The first thing we will cover is setting up the programs.
When you first load SHELL Modem Menu you should see a
question mark at each selection. You must push the letter S
and then it will ask you to push the number you wish to edit.
Then a box will come up that looks something like:
╔═════════════════════════════════════╗
║ Program Name: ░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░ ║
║ File Name: ░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░ ║
║ Path Of File: ░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░░ ║
╚═════════════════════════════════════╝
The first selection you should come to is Program Name:. In
this box you should type in the name of the program that you
would like to be displayed on the menu. The next box is the
File Name:. In this box, type in the filename of the
program. Example of a filename: EXAMPLE.EXE. The filename
must include the .EXE, .COM, or .BAT extension. The next box
is the Path Of File:. In this box you should enter the path
of the file. Example of a path: C:\EXAMPLE\. You MUST
include the slash (\) at the end of the path. If the program
is in the same directory as the menu you do not need to put a
path in. Then press the letter Q to go back to the main menu
and then press the selection number that you chose to see if
it worked. If you went back to the box like that above you
needed to press the letter Q until you got out of the setup
part of the program.
Hardware Requirements: IBM PC/XT/AT or Compatible
computer, 520k RAM
Other Requirements: DOS 3.x or higher
